EFMD Case Writing Awards 2015

SMU has set a new record with three awards clinched in the EDMD Case Writing Competition organised by the European Foundation for Management Development (EFMD). The winning SMU cases were co-authored by a combination of case writers from the Case Writing Initiative driven by the SMU Centre for Management Practice (CMP), as well as faculty, staff and industry partners. SMU bagged three awards out of 17 in total in the most recent competition. The winning cases included “Manila Water: From Privitisation to Sustainable Growth” (Inclusive Business Models category, co-authored by former CEO of Human Capital Leadership Institute Kwan Chee Wei, SMU CMP Senior Case Writer Christopher Dula and SMU CMP Case Writer Zack Wang); “SimplyFlying: Making a Great Idea Take Flight (A) and (B)” (Entrepreneurship category, co-authored by Academic Director of SMU Executive Development Dr Michael Netzley, Senior Case Writer Adina Wong and Robert Speculand); and “The Senior Citizen Home Safety Association: Enabling Active, Ageing-in-place in Hong Kong” (Urban Transition Challenges new category, co-authored by Adjunct Faculty at SMU School of Information Systems Alfred Wu and SMU CMP Senior Case Writer Christopher Dula).
